Java 类org.apache.hadoop.hbase.client.coprocessor.DoubleColumnInterpreter 实例源码
项目:ditb
文件:TestDoubleColumnInterpreter.java
@Test(timeout = 300000)
public void testMaxWithInvalidRange() {
AggregationClient aClient = new AggregationClient(conf);
final ColumnInterpreter<Double, Double, EmptyMsg, DoubleMsg, DoubleMsg> ci =
new DoubleColumnInterpreter();
Scan scan = new Scan();
scan.setStartRow(ROWS[4]);
scan.setStopRow(ROWS[2]);
scan.addColumn(TEST_FAMILY, TEST_QUALIFIER);
double max = Double.MIN_VALUE;
;
try {
max = aClient.max(TEST_TABLE, ci, scan);
} catch (Throwable e) {
max = 0.00;
}
assertEquals(0.00, max, 0.00);// control should go to the catch block
}
